serological response of cats to experimental besnoitia darlingi and besnoitia neotomofelis infections and prevalence of antibodies to these parasites in cats from virginia and pennsylvania.abstract besnoitia darlingi and besnoitia neotomofelis are cyst-forming tissue apicomplexan parasites that use domestic cats ( felis domesticus ) as definitive hosts and opossums ( didelphis virginiana ) and southern plains woodrats ( neotoma micropus ) as intermediate hosts, respectively. nothing is known about the prevalence of b. darlingi or b. neotomofelis in cats from the united states. besnoitia darlingi infections have been reported in naturally infected opossums from many states in the u ...201121506782
isolation of neospora caninum from naturally infected white-tailed deer (odocoileus virginianus).attempts were made to isolate neospora caninum from naturally infected white-tailed deer (odocoileus virginianus). a total of 110 deer killed during the 2003 hunting season in virginia region were used for the isolation of n. caninum. of these, brains from 28 deer that had nat titer of 1:200 were inoculated into interferon-gamma gene knock out (ko) mice. n. caninum was isolated from the tissues of three deer and all three isolates were mildly virulent to ko mice. only one of the isolates could b ...200515845280
